How do you use potpourri oil?

Place a couple of drops of your most loved fragrance oils to your air filter and the fragrance will diffuse each time the fan taps on. Place a few drops on potpourri to the scent levels of your desire. Over time potpourri loses it once strong scent and can be brought back to life with fragrance oils.

How do you activate potpourri?

You can buy essential and/or fragrant oils, such as cinnamon, rose, sandalwood and lavender, at candle shops or at bed, bath and beauty stores. Sprinkle a few drops over the potpourri (use sparingly; these liquids are very strong), then stir or toss gently.

What is the best way to use potpourri?

You can place potpourri in fabric bags (sachets) and put them in drawers and closets to scent clothing. Put them in storage boxes, chests, musty cupboards to create pleasant aromas. Tie them to doorknobs. Squeeze them once in awhile to release the scent.

How do you use potpourri fragrance?

To give your clothes a natural fragrance or aroma, you can make small sachets of potpourri of the fragrance you like and place them in your drawers and wardrobes. They can also be placed in your suitcases, storage cabinets, coats and even shoes.

Why do people use potpourri?

Today potpourri is used primarily to freshen rooms. Mixtures placed in clear, attractive containers are quite decorative because of the muted colors of the dried herbs and flowers. Sachets are now used to perfume linens and clothes.

What is the most common use for potpourri?

Today, potpourri is mostly used for its pleasant scent and its ability to freshen up a room. Potpourri can be made with fresh or dried flowers, spices, and other ingredients. The key to making a good potpourri is to choose ingredients that complement each other and that will hold their fragrant or scent over time.

How do you use oil to scent a room?

Many people like to add a few drops of oil to clothespins and then clip them on objects around the house for an easy DIY diffuser. You can also do the same with wooden ornaments and hang them like air fresheners.

Can potpourri grow mold?

If you have potpourri, though, how do you know if it’s bad? The first thing you need to do is look for any discolorations. If it’s yellow or brown, that means mold spores are growing in the potpourri, and it needs to be cleaned out immediately.
